About

Hyeong‐Kyu Lee is a scholar working on Molecular Biology, Plant Science and Pharmacology. According to data from OpenAlex, Hyeong‐Kyu Lee has authored 131 papers receiving a total of 3.6k indexed citations (citations by other indexed papers that have themselves been cited), including 87 papers in Molecular Biology, 39 papers in Plant Science and 21 papers in Pharmacology. Recurrent topics in Hyeong‐Kyu Lee’s work include Natural product bioactivities and synthesis (44 papers), Phytochemistry and Biological Activities (30 papers) and Plant-derived Lignans Synthesis and Bioactivity (13 papers). Hyeong‐Kyu Lee is often cited by papers focused on Natural product bioactivities and synthesis (44 papers), Phytochemistry and Biological Activities (30 papers) and Plant-derived Lignans Synthesis and Bioactivity (13 papers). Hyeong‐Kyu Lee collaborates with scholars based in South Korea, China and United States. Hyeong‐Kyu Lee's co-authors include Sei‐Ryang Oh, Byung Sun Min, Kyung‐Seop Ahn, Ok‐Kyoung Kwon, Jungsook Cho, Young‐Won Chin, Jung‐Hee Kim, KiHwan Bae, Mee-Young Lee and Boyoung Park and has published in prestigious journals such as Development, Applied and Environmental Microbiology and Biochemical and Biophysical Research Communications.
